About Integral University
Established under Act 9 of 2004, Integral University, Lucknow, is India’s first enacted Minority University. Recognized by UGC, NAAC (A+), and DSIR, the university is committed to academic excellence in various disciplines, including law.

List of Cases (Choose One for Analysis)
- Vellore Citizens Welfare Forum v. Union of India (1996) – Environmental Degradation and Water Pollution
Citation: AIR 1996 SC 2715 - M.C. Mehta v. Union of India (2002) – CNG Vehicle Case
Citation: AIR 2002 SC 1696 - Church of God (Full Gospel) in India v. K.K.R. Majestic Colony Welfare Association (2000) – Noise Pollution Case
Citation: AIR 2000 SC 2773 - Narmada Bachao Andolan v. Union of India & Others (2000) – Sardar Sarovar Dam Case
Citation: AIR 2000 SC 3751 - M.C. Mehta v. Union of India (1996) – Taj Trapezium Case
Citation: AIR 1997 SC 734
